Contact网页2017年12月1日For the ball mill, corundum balls with diameters of 21, 16 and 12 mm were used as grinding media.For the rod mill, corundum rods of 15 and 11 mm in diameter and 15 cm in length were used.Scheelite samples with a total mass of 200 g were fed into the mill and ground for 30 s each run to prevent over-grinding.After a run, the ground

Contact网页For the flotation tests, the samples were ground to 80% passing 50 microns; the grinding media used in the flotation testing were 100% stainless steel. After grinding, the slurry was transferred into a 4.3 L flotation cell, conditioned with lime (1100g/t), the collector 3418A (30g/t in total) and frother MIBC (70 µL).
